The Romans (Al-Room)
In the name of Allah, the Merciful, the Compassionate
۞ Alif. Lam. Mim. 1 The Greeks have been vanquished 2 in the lands close-by; yet it is they who, notwithstanding this their defeat, shall be victorious 3 In a few years (less than ten). God's is the imperative first and last. On that day the believers will rejoice 4 in God's help; God helps whomsoever He will; and He is the All-mighty, the All-compassionate. 5 It is a promise of God; and God does not go back on His promise. Yet most men do not understand: 6 they know but the outer surface of this world's life, whereas of the ultimate things they are utterly unaware. 7 Do they not contemplate within themselves? Allah has not created the heavens and the earth and what is between them except in truth and for a specified term. And indeed, many of the people, in [the matter of] the meeting with their Lord, are disbelievers. 8 Have they not travelled through the land to see how terrible was the end of the people who lived before them. The people who lived before them were stronger than them in might, in tilling, and in developing the earth. Our Messengers came to them with clear miracles. God did not do an injustice to them but they wronged themselves. 9 Evil was the end of those evil-doers, for they gave the lie to Allah's Signs and scoffed at them. 10
